Part 01

AI tools enhance critical thinking development

AI tools like Socratic by Google are game-changers in education. They enable problem-based learning, which is crucial for developing critical thinking skills. These tools present students with complex problems requiring analysis and synthesis, rather than mere fact recall. For instance, AI can simulate historical events, prompting students to explore outcomes based on different decisions. This exploration fosters a deeper understanding of how interconnected systems operate, encouraging students to think beyond the surface level.

Part 02

From rote learning to analytical prowess

Traditional education models emphasized memorization, but this approach is increasingly inadequate. With AI like GPT-4 providing instant data access, the true value lies in how students interpret and apply information. By integrating AI into curricula, educators can focus on developing students' analytical prowess. This includes encouraging debates using AI-generated prompts or exploring ethical implications of AI decisions, pushing students to think critically about real-world issues.

Part 03

The role of educators in an AI-driven classroom

Educators are pivotal in leveraging AI to enhance critical thinking. They must transition from being knowledge providers to facilitators of inquiry. This involves curating AI tools that promote student interaction and discussion rather than passive consumption of content. Tools like AI-assisted debate platforms can be used to present diverse perspectives on issues, compelling students to evaluate arguments critically and develop their reasoning skills.

The signal

Why this matters now

Educators can leverage AI to foster deeper critical thinking skills, shifting away from rote memorization. This approach prepares students for a world where AI handles basic tasks, and human value lies in nuanced judgment and creativity.

In practice

How to apply it today

Incorporate AI tools like Socratic by Google to create problem-solving scenarios that require students to apply critical thinking rather than recall information. Use AI-assisted debate platforms to encourage diverse perspectives and analysis.

A history teacher uses GPT-4 to generate hypothetical scenarios around a historical event, prompting students to analyze the outcomes of different decisions. This helps students explore multiple viewpoints and develop critical reasoning skills.
